The Crays Collaborative PCN is anetwork of 6 GP surgeries whichare Broomwood Surgery, Crescent Surgery, Derry Downs Surgery, Gillmans RoadSurgery, Poverest Medical Centre and St Mary Cray Practice.
The PCN are looking for a Care Coordinator to join their team.
Care co-ordinatorshelp to co-ordinate and navigate care across the health and care system,helping people make the right connections, with the right teams at the righttime. They can support people to become more active in their own health andcare and are skilled in assessing peoples changing needs. Care co-ordinatorsare effective in bringing together multidisciplinary teams to supportpeoples complex health and care needs.
They can be aneffective intervention in supporting people to stay well particularly thosewith long term conditions, multiple long-term conditions, and people livingwith or at risk of frailty.
BGPA is a federation of all 43 Bromley practices working collaboratively to enhance the health and wellbeing of Bromley residents, covering over 350,000 patients, 100% of the Bromley population.
BGPAs goals are to work strategically with Bromley practices to help secure the best services for patients whilst working together to support member practices in the challenges of a changing NHS.
BGPA aims to improve the morale of general practice in Bromley by sharing expertise, services and supporting its workforce.
BGPA will make a positive impact on medical services in Bromley by working closely with One Bromley Partners including NHS SEL ICB, local NHS trusts, local providers and patient groups, to improve the delivery of healthcare to the local population.
